# The People - The people at Gusto are phenomenal! These are some of the most brilliant people I've worked with. The Invite Team (aka recruiting) in particular works really well within our team and across cross-functional teams. People really care about each other here. We give "kudos" in our team meetings and highlight our peers' accomplishments. I feel that my managers and mentors are invested in my growth and learning. # The Space - Our new office is BEAUTIFUL! There's lots of extra desk space, couch space, and opportunity to stand/sit away from your desk. Plus I love our community mural (and the couches are comfy :-). There are also little tributes around the office to our Gusto customers! # The Culture - We're encouraged to celebrate our peers' victories, cover for each other when OOO, and take time off to be with family and volunteer. There's a culture of care and empathy here at Gusto that I haven't experienced anywhere else. There's also a lot of transparency within the company. During our company-wide meetings, the exec team hosts a monthly Q&A. These are recorded and distributed to the rest of the company at the end of each meeting - it's a great way to stay informed and ask questions (no matter how difficult).

Svantaggi

#The Commute - Commuting for me personally is fine thanks to carpool. However, it's been a pain point for Gusties living in the East Bay

The product is genuinely good, too bad the same can’t be said for how they treat the people who sell it.

Svantaggi

Leadership talks a big game about people-first culture but the reality doesn’t match. The Chicago office expansion felt like a poorly thought-out experiment, new hires were brought on without a clear long-term commitment, and layoffs came without warning, leaving people blindsided. Crossing a billion dollars in revenue and still cutting employees sends a clear message about where workers rank on the priority list. Remote work flexibility is also a glaring weakness. For a company selling HR software to modern businesses, their internal stance on where employees can work is surprisingly rigid and hypocritical. The “flexibility” messaging is mostly optics. The broader concern is the AI roadmap. The automation push feels less like an innovation strategy and more like a slow wind-down of the workforce. Employees aren’t blind to it, it creates anxiety and erodes trust. The culture of transparency they promote externally is largely a facade internally.
